A member asked:

Are constipation & bed wetting related?

Possibly: The rectum is posterior to the bladder. Stool in the lower intestine, or rectum, can push against the bladder and reduce its capacity to hold urine. In recent study, four out of five demonstrated stool burden consistent with constipation. Many times constipation not apparent. Urinary tract infections in children are also similarly related to constipation.
